Make an Elf Clock
Do you know how to tell time? You can download this activity sheet, and make your own clock to practice telling time with your family or your elf. Just print out the activity sheet and follow the instructions. Be careful with the sharp tools and enjoy your new clock!

YOU'LL NEED:
- 1 Empty Cereal Box
- Markers or Crayons
- Glitter (Optional)
- Clear Tape
- Gift Wrapping Paper
- Glue
- Scissors
- AA Battery (Refer to Quartz Package for details)
- Quartz Clock Movement Package (Available at most craft/hobby stores)
DIRECTIONS:
- Gather your materials
- Open the bottom portion of the cereal box and tape the top of the box shut.
- Use your scissors (ask an adult for help) and pierce the center of the front of the box with scissors. You will want to make a hole about the size of a pea.
- Wrap the cereal box in gift wrap paper leaving the bottom of the box open and unwrapped.
- Use your finger and feel for the hole in the cereal box underneath the wrapping paper.
- Place two pieces of clear tape on top of the hole. Then, pierce through the tape and wrapping paper once again.
- Use your markers/crayons and glitter (optional) and decorate your elf clock pattern. DOWNLOAD PATTERN
- Use your scissors and cut the elf clock pattern out.
- Place your decorated elf clock pattern on the front of the box, and match up the hole in your box with the circle noted on your elf pattern.
- Glue or tape the pattern onto the box.
- Pierce through the center hole once again using your scissors.
- Ask an adult to help you and follow the directions on your quartz clock movement package.
- First, insert the battery into the movement box.
- Insert the movement box in to the bottom of the cereal box and place the shaft/rod through the center hole you created.
- Follow the remaining directions on the quartz clock movement packaging to attach the hour, minute, and second hand to your clock.
- Reach inside the cereal box and set the time on the clock correctly. (Most will have a small dial on the back of the movement box.) See your individual package directions for further clarification.
- Tape the bottom of the box closed.
- If you have a slight overhang of wrapping paper on the bottom of the box, fold it under and tape it securely so you will have a flat surface on which the clock will sit.
- Enjoy telling time using your Elf on the Shelf clock!
